Old Chapel House is a five-bedroom detached house in Boxford, Sudbury, Sudbury (CO10 5NR). It has a recorded floor area of 228 m² (around 2454 sq ft) and construction records dating it to before 1900. The latest certificate (April 2015) shows an E (score 50),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 81), a 3-band jump. Main heating runs on oil. The latest certificate is from April 2015,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Other recorded features include a conservatory and attached land beyond the plot. Period features are noted in the property record.

At 228 m² the property is well over the postcode median (121 m² across 14 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. 2 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include an extension, solar panel installation, partial demolition and tree works,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Across 2015–2023, sale prices on this property compounded at 2%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£348/sq ft) was about 61.1%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£855,000 in August 2023.
